| Spec | 2026 Hyundai Venue SE | 2026 Buick Encore GX Preferred |
|---|---|---|
| Pricing | ||
| MSRP | $20,550 | $27,900 |
| Powertrain | ||
| Engine | 1.6L I4 | 1.3L I3 Turbo |
| Horsepower | 121 hp | 155 hp |
| Torque | 113 lb-ft | 174 lb-ft |
| Transmission | continuously variable-speed automatic | 9-speed shiftable automatic |
| Drivetrain | FWD | AWD |
| Fuel Economy | ||
| City MPG | 29 | 26 |
| Highway MPG | 33 | 28 |
| Combined MPG | 31 | 27 |
| Fuel Tank | 11.9 gal | 13.2 gal |
| Annual Fuel Cost (EPA) | $1,400/yr | No published data |
| Dimensions | ||
| Curb Weight | 2,738 lbs | 3,255 lbs |
| Wheelbase | 99.2" | 102.0" |
| Length | 159.1" | 171.2" |
| Width | 69.7" | 71.4" |
| Height | 61.6" | 64.5" |
| Safety | ||
| NHTSA Overall | 4/5 stars | 5/5 stars |
| Warranty | ||
| Bumper-to-Bumper | 5yr/60k | 3yr/36k |
| Powertrain | 10yr/100k | 5yr/60k |
| Corrosion | 7yr/unlimited | 6yr/100k |
| Roadside Assistance | 5yr/unlimited | 5yr/60k |

The Venue–Encore GX Decision
Cross-shopping subcompact SUVs means weighing interior space, ride quality, and ownership costs. Here is how the Venue and Encore GX compare. The $7,350 gap adds up to $129/month on a 60-month loan. That is real money, so the pricier option needs to earn it with capabilities you will actually use.
What Powers Each Vehicle
The 2026 Hyundai Venue SE runs a 1.6L I4; the 2026 Buick Encore GX Preferred uses a 1.3L I3 Turbo. The 2026 Buick Encore GX Preferred has 34 more hp (155 vs 121), enough to notice on highway on-ramps and when passing. The 2026 Buick Encore GX Preferred adds 61 more lb-ft of torque (174 vs 113), giving it stronger low-end pull off the line. The 2026 Buick Encore GX Preferred comes with AWD; the 2026 Hyundai Venue SE uses FWD. If you deal with snow, rain, or gravel roads, that traction advantage matters.
The Ownership Math
The 2026 Hyundai Venue SE saves roughly $201/year on fuel at $3.50/gallon and 12,000 annual miles. Over five years, that is $1,005. The 2026 Hyundai Venue SE wins on both sticker price and running costs, making it the stronger value on paper.
Living With the Venue vs the Encore GX
The 2026 Buick Encore GX Preferred is 12.1″ longer, which translates to more room inside but a larger footprint in parking lots and garages. The 2026 Buick Encore GX Preferred weighs 517 lbs more. Heavier vehicles tend to feel more planted at highway speed but use more fuel and are harder to stop quickly.
